For many Indonesian students ranging from elementary to college students,
mathematics is the most difficult subject. Based on the results of a survey conducted by PISA conducted in 65 countries in 2012, said the ability of Indonesian student mathematics ranked lower with a score of 375. Only 1% of Indonesian students has have good skills in the field of mathematics. From the above research as well as my experience, i agree that math is a difficult subject. There are factors that make math difficult. They are formulas, numbers (counting), and teacher. Mathematics is considered a difficult lesson because students have already assumed that mathematics is difficult and complicated, since it always deals with formulas. There are many formulas used to solve simple problems that confuse the students. The formulas are too many and similar which make the students not interested in and lazy to learn even before they try it. The students has been practicing using different types of formula but what comes in the exam is different. Memorizing answers does not help the students in math. Otherwise, they should count and calculate. The formula can be the same, but different numbers must be calculated and counted again, that's math. The absence of a story line where there are only numbers and numbers makes students easily bored. Another factor that makes mathematics difficult is the teacher. It includes teacher’s attitude, appearance, and manner in delivering the materials. Looking creepy or being a killer teacher who likes to punish the students who does not do the task or does not understand some material, become two of the causes why students do not like math. Sometimes some math teachers convey the materials poorly that makes the students bored. Math is considered a difficult subject because the students have to memorize many formulas and count the numbers, which also make them bored. What make mathematics even more difficult are the teacher’s attitude, appearance and the way they teach. However, the students need to study math because mathematics has a very important role in everyday life. A real example in of using the math is the process of buying and selling in which we use the elements of arithmetic that exist in mathematics.
